Welcome to Sunset Texas Barbecue

At Sunset Texas Barbecue, we celebrate the rich tradition of Texas-style barbecue right here in Honolulu. Our story began with a passion for crafting mouthwatering smoked meats, where each bite of our tender brisket and juicy beef ribs reflects time-honored techniques and the love we put into our food. The inviting ambience encourages gatherings with friends and family, while our attention to detail shines through in every flavorful dish. With options like flavorful pulled pork and sides that complement our craft meats, we cater to all, ensuring an unforgettable dining experience rooted in hospitality and quality. Had a chance to lunch with a friend and we both wanted to try here. Paid street parking only, but there's quite a lot of stalls around the area. Walking in, it smelled heavenly...smoky, meaty, delicious. Plates to choose from, as well as ordering ala carte. You order at their counter, which is kinda like cafeteria style, and have a seat. Tables are throughout the establishment, with different views. The main dining area is filled with bbq/Texas memorabilia, but down the hallway, you have a view of their bbq smokers and possibly an inside peek of their process. I ordered cole slaw, cornbread, and brisket. The person carving the brisket gave me a little extra, which I appreciated because my lunch came out to just shy of $50!!! Though pricey and definitely not a come-here-often kind of place, the brisket was delicious...smoky, juicy, and tender. Cole slaw was fresh, with crunch and not too sweet. I was disappointed with the cornbread...way too moist and sweet for my liking because it seemed to have creamed corn mixed in. I prefer my cornbread on the drier side with a grainier cornmeal texture. Overall, this place is a must try since there aren't many BBQ places around town, but it'll be a splurge meal.

Sunset Texas Barbecue has been on my list of places to eat so we checked it out on a Saturday. Love the way they get you at you enter the door and all the signage and pictures on display. Ordering is simple when you order a plate. It comes with 2 scoups of rice and you chose 2 sides and your choice of meat. You can also order by the pound and take it home. I decided on the slaw, beans and smoked brisket, the plate also came pickle and onions and 2 sauces to try. Being out was a Saturday the Beef Rib was available that you can purchase separately, it was huge. The brisket had a nice smoke ring and was so tender, delicious! We shared the Beef Rib, great flavor and equally tender and tasty. It's a carnivore dream to eat a plate or one of the many smoked items. Definitely come back and try the other offerings.
